MINDY JO O'GUIN, age 38, of East Prairie, died Friday, July 24, 2020, at Southeast Health in Cape Girardeau.

Born May 19, 1982, at Sikeston, MO, to William Davis "David" O'Guin and Kathy Lisa Gaddy O'Guin, who survive of East Prairie, she was a 2000 graduate of East Prairie High School and went on to graduate from Missouri State University in Springfield with a degree in criminal justice and was a member of the SAI Sorority.  Growing up in East Prairie, she later developed a love for the city of St. Louis where she made her home.  She joined the Missouri National Guard and was called to active duty two times, serving in Iraq and Kuwait.  She loved her family and spending time with her nephews and nieces, she enjoyed music and playing the trumpet, reading, swimming and spending time with her friends and military companions.  She especially loved her yorkie fur baby, Murray.

Surviving in addition to her mother and father are her brother, William (Jessica) O'Guin of Benton and her sister, Courtney (Patrick) Smith of East Prairie; her nephews and nieces, Declan O'Guin, Savannah Smith, Hailey Smith, Samuel Smith and Lucas Smith and her niece, Caitlyn Quinn Smith, to be born soon.

Preceding her in death were her paternal grandparents, Eugene and Shirley Ann Ashley O'Guin and her maternal grandparents, Elmer and Earlene Allen Gaddy.
